    Who is Dr. Merker, Internist in New York, NY?

    Dr. Edward Merker, MD is an Internist, who primarily practices in New York, NY with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Merker completed his residency at Mt Sinai Med Ctr, Endocrinology, Diabetes & Metabolism; Elmhurst Hosp Ctr-Mt Sinai, Internal Medicine; Mt Sinai Med Ctr, Internal Medicine; Barnes-Jewish Hosp-S Campus, Flexible Or Transitional Year. He is a member of the AMA, ATA, ADA, ENDOCRINE SOCIETY, and PITUITARY SOCIETY. Dr. Merker is fluent in English and French, and is currently seeing new patients.     What is Dr. Edward Merker's specialty?

    Dr. Merker is a Internist near New York, NY.

    A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.

    Is this Dr. Edward Merker aff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Merker is affiliated with Lenox Hill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
